Transaction 531f41377e29d47e06d00d59d23af358df6db984b29fe822e242011bdaeea4a5

1 Input
2 Outputs
  • 531f41377e29d47e06d00d59d23af358df6db984b29fe822e242011bdaeea4a5:0
  • value  16403314
    address  3H7BDXxGeMH4EYFRtsB42e75WMa7fSmMrw
  • 531f41377e29d47e06d00d59d23af358df6db984b29fe822e242011bdaeea4a5:1
  • value  10845358
    address  1JP8FqoXtCMrR1sZc2McLWmHxENox1Y1PV